Social Work 778

This class teaches students to use advanced clinical skills across settings. The course builds on Social Work 776, preparing students for advanced clinical work. This course focuses predominantly on Evidence Based Interventions. Utilizing examples from field placement experience in conjunction with classroom instruction, students will learn to select and implement appropriate interventions for clients.

Other Requirements: PREREQ: SOCWORK 776 AND ENROLLMENT IN SOCIAL WORK (MSW)
